Background technique
It when processing filtering screen used for automobile air conditioning, needs to carry out cutting work to it, currently, usually logical It crosses man-hour manually hand-held cutting machine and carries out cutting work, when use is easy to produce a large amount of dust, is easy to cause to endanger to human body and environment Evil is pressed from both sides moreover, needing to clamp filtering screen in cutting processing currently, chucking device is usually used alone It holds, it is complex for operation step, a large amount of manpowers are wasted, therefore, it is necessary to improve.

When needing to process filtering screen, the 4th motor 101 of starting drives the second spiral shell shape bar 105 to rotate, and second Spiral shell shape bar 105 drives outer housing 121 to rise, and then, the second pneumatic cylinder 162 of starting pushes forward clamping frame 106 to skid off working chamber 120, filtering screen is put into clamping chamber 108, the clamping plate 111 that the first pneumatic cylinder 109 pushes the left and right sides is then started Relative movement clamps filtering screen, and then clamping frame 106 is moved to cutting blade by the second pneumatic cylinder of reverse starting 162 131 downsides, then the 4th motor 101 of reverse starting drives the decline of outer housing 121 to abut with pedestal 100, at this point, working chamber 120 are in closed state, then start the first motor 148 and cutting blade 131 is driven to rotate, meanwhile, start third motor 124 drive the decline of falsework 125 to carry out cutting processing to filtering screen;
When needing dismounting and change cutting blade 131, the second motor 144 of starting drives regulation block 149 to decline, and regulates and controls block 149 Connecting rod 139 pushes the first sliding block 134 to slide to the right when decline, at this point, steering shaft 133 is detached from the second reeve chamber 132 and skids off Chamber 145 is imbedded, then, pushing cutting blade 131 to the right can make to inject block 147 manually is detached from the first reeve chamber 146, this When, under cutting blade 131 can be dismantled.
